ADVERTISING ON THIS SITE

BIN/IIN: 539817

BIN/IIN 539817
Brand MASTERCARD
Type DEBIT
Category PREPAID RELOADABLE
Bank DIAMOND TRUST BANK KENYA, LTD.
Country Kenya
Country Short KE